Rippln: the innovative pyramid scheme Rippln terrifies me. It's a pyramid scheme that is designed with the expressed intent of revolutionizing the pyramid scheme. Participants don't pay money, instead they advertise products, and instead of a pyramid, you have a ripple, even though it is usually shown structured and angled as one. This lack of cost is the trade-off the pyramid scheme industry has been looking for. You download an app, invite 5 other people to download the app, then they invite their own friends. They do this 14 times until there aren't enough people in the world to invite. Then once the ripple begins to stagnate, Rippln starts sending app advertisements through its app and makes off with it, compensating you but not your fans, who would only download the app to make money themselves. When I visited the [Rippln website](http://www.ripplnmobile.com), I arrived to a plethora on meaningless buzzwords like Appify Everything and Gamify Everything. Rippln recycles the hype that social media gurus stopped handing out only a while ago. Rippln demonstrates its [comp plan](https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=lp2KkmpAWf4) with a video that is designed to be confusing with its overly-complicated but essentially infinite-pyramid shaped model. It's all Then I visited [their Facebook page](https://www.facebook.com/Rippln) and I was even more horrified when I saw [this](https://www.facebook.com/photo.php?fbid=453434644737260&set=a.449153441832047.1073741828.414185025328889&type=1). A poster full of affectionate motivational quotes that remind you that by joining Rippln, you shall become the driving force of your community, changing the world by doing something you have yet to even understand. These are all ideas that resonate with the most hopeless parts of society, those who have lost everything and look towards these methods of making money fast.
